 You need a video cable with a 3W3 connector on one end. Original was likely a DEC BC29G-10.
That, plus 5BNC-to-VGA cables, and 3 F/F BNC barrels, will work with a multisync monitor that handles sync-on-green.

I just went through this with several DECstations, where the Turbochannel graphics options have the same 3W3 connector.

 I assume it would be way too much to hope that HD BNC would fit it?  Does
anyone have a pointer to the actual physical dimensions of the itty-bitty
BNC-ish connector in the video port of the VAXStation4000vlc?  If I can get
red, green, and blue out (assuming since there are only 3 connectors it's
sync-on-green) I can put together a sync splitter and turn it into VGA.  I
have at least one decent multisync VGA monitor still, although none with
the RGB BNC inputs.
